Team behind Zero Dark Thirty developing 10-hour TV event about 2016 election
Even though some people are still hoping that the 2016 presidential election will get a surprise twist ending any day now (one involving a word that rhymes with “chimpreachment”), writer Mark Boal and producer Megan Ellison have announced that they’re developing an “eight to 10-hour” television event about it. That comes from The Hollywood Reporter, which helpfully notes that the election “ultimately came down to the face-off of candidates Donald Trump and Hillary Clinton” and that it is “a very contentions topic in America” to this day.
